The Road Less Traveled: Alumni Perceptions Of The Georgia Early College High School Experience, Tequila Tranise Morgan Jan 2015

The Road Less Traveled: Alumni Perceptions Of The Georgia Early College High School Experience, Tequila Tranise Morgan

Electronic Theses and Dissertations

Despite the efforts of traditional high schools to educate all students, at-risk populations tend to lag behind their White and more affluent counterparts in educational achievement, high school graduation rates, and college attendance rates. Early College High Schools (ECHSs) were designed to attract and retain at-risk students through rigorous academic practices, strong support systems, and by providing free access to college credits while students are still in high school.

With the case study approach as a guide, this research used an open-ended interview protocol to collect data from a sample of 16 students who attended one ECHS in Georgia between …
